The issue with dispatcher is that, in case of TCP transport, you cannot set the sending socket for the same reason. Basically, each time a client TCP socket is open by Kamailio, the SO select the port, due to the lack of support for SO_REUSEPORT.

Better than using qualify in asterisk is to use the dispatcher module in kamailio. The idea is the same, but more configurable and it is just 1 keepalive mechanisme so the amount of keepalives doesn't scale linear with the number of registered users :)
